Overview: Learn Access® database and integration with Excel® and Word® in your own computer lab. This engaging, professional workshop delivers highly concentrated information with one instructor teaching and the other walking around the room to help keep each participant up to speed. Well-received by teacher audiences who have compared this workshop to an entire “course,” feedback continues to be overwhelmingly positive and word of mouth is still our primary form of advertising.
Background: UIL State Computer Applications Director, Linda Tarrant has been conducting Computer Applications workshops in Educational Service Centers in Texas since 2005. Linda and daughter, Huntley Tarrant, VP of Mindbites (Austin, TX) and Harvard Business School graduate, have conducted classes in San Angelo, Abilene, Midland, and Plano, Texas. Linda Tarrant is also the President and founder of Hexco Academic publishing company.
Set-up/Requirements: Room with computers, a projector and screen with Office 2007 or 2010 available or laptop connection, and optional network access for file retrieval by students.
Available workshops: Two 1-day workshops are available. These can be taught singly or on two consecutive days. There is little overlap, but some of the same topics will be covered or reviewed in the Intermediate/Advanced course, which is at a slightly higher level. Workshops Syllabus is shown below.
